""Sketch of the History of the House of Russell"" is a book written by David Ross in 1848. This historical account traces the lineage and history of the Russell family, one of the most influential families in England. The book covers the family's origins in the 15th century, through their rise to power during the Tudor and Stuart periods, and up to the 19th century. The author provides a detailed account of the family's political and social influence, including their involvement in the English Civil War, the Glorious Revolution, and the formation of the Whig Party. The book also explores the family's contributions to the arts, sciences, and philanthropy, including their patronage of the poet John Milton and the founding of the Bedford Charity. Overall, ""Sketch of the History of the House of Russell"" provides a comprehensive and fascinating look into the history of one of England's most prominent families.This scarce antiquarian book is a facsimile reprint of the old original and may contain some imperfections such as library marks and notations.
